I will be going with the family to Disney for five days then to Sarasota to visit some family. I am doing a Tri in August and will only have one week to "prepare" after I return. I know that I can run easily wherever I go, but would like to swim a few times. Anyone have experience swimming at Disney? There is a bunch of pools - but do any of them have lap times? Particularly early in the AM? Any help in Sarasota would be welcomed too.

    Originally posted by Scansy For the record, the resort we were at in Disney (Pop Century) had three swimming pools open 24 hours. Lifegaurds from 10:00am to 10:00pm. The rest of the time it was swim at your own risk. It felt odd to be doing a workout at 6:00 am in a pool shaped like a bowling pin!:) Sarasota was much easier - a week membership at the Y. A pool shaped like a BOWLING PIN!! That is funny! :D How long was it? Did you swim at the new Y in Sarasota - the one out near the interstate? That's a great pool - they had Y Nationals there a couple of times.
